6-3. Adjustment Procedure

6-3-1. CCD2CH Adjustment (CCD2CH)

Devices to use:
- Dedicated power supply (accessory)
- Lens hood
- SD card
The SD card needs to contain the adjustment firmware. Make sure the firmware is written to root
directory.
- Standard light source
It takes several minutes to stabilize the luminosity. Before stating the adjustment, it is recommended to
wait for 10 minutes after the power is turned on.
1) Confirm that the AC adapter is connected, lens food is attached, and SD card with adjustment firmware is
inserted to the camera.
2) Set the dial of the standard light source at 11LV.
3) Place the camera in the position where the lens hood can tightly fit to the luminosity side of the standard light
source (Fig. 6.3.1.1).
4) Turn on the camera with holding the MENU button.
5) The adjustment menu shown in Fig. 6.3.1.2 will be displayed on
the LCD monitor. Select "CCD 2CH" by rotating the JOG dial or by
pushing up/down the OK button, and press the OK button down to
right to proceed.
6) The image shown in Fig. 6.3.1.3 will be displayed on the LCD
monitor. Press the OK button to proceed.
7) After the automatic adjustment, the result will be displayed at the
bottom of monitor screen within several seconds. As shown in Fig.
6.3.1.4, the adjustment is completed when "SUCCESS" is
displayed. As shown in Fig. 6.3.1.5, the adjustment is failed when
"FAILURE" is displayed, and re-adjustment will be required.
8) Return to the adjustment menu (Fig. 6.3.1.2) by pushing the OK
button down to left in order to continue the adjustment for other
items. Turn off the camera to end the adjustment.
